10th International Conference on Prenatal Diagnosis and Therapy
Barcelona, Spain, 19 - 22 June 2000

Under the auspices of the International Society for Prenatal Diagnosis



State of the Art Plenary Sessions - Free Communications - Poster Sessions
  • Epidemiology and Pathology of Fetal Anomalies
  • Fetal Infections
  • Ultrasound and Maternal Serum Screening
  • First Trimester U.S.
  • Non-Invasive Diagnosis
  • (Fetal cells in maternal circulation, Fetal DNA in
  • maternal serum and plasma, Cervical mucus cells...)
  • Invasive Diagnostic Procedures
  • Pre-Implantation Genetic Diagnosis
  • Prevention in Preconception and Antenatal Care
  • Psychosocial Aspects of Prenatal Diagnosis
  • Organization and Evaluation of Services
  • Medical and Surgical Therapies of Fetal Disorders
  • (Endoscopy, Gene therapy, Stem cells...)
  • Advances in Cell Culture and Cytogenetic Techniques
  • Advances in Molecular Cytogenetics (FISH)
  • Developments in Genetic Linkage and DNA Analysis
  • Genetic Counseling
  • Prenatal Diagnosis in Twins and Higher Order Pregnancies
  • Selective Termination
